This manual for applied behavior analysis parent training professionals includes 26 lessons (plus one bonus lesson) that you can use to provide biweekly parent training sessions for one full year. However, you may use the lessons at any rate and in any order that is appropriate for the family you are supporting. This ABA parent training program offers a structured curriculum that also allows for flexibility and individualization for the client! Each lesson is jam-packed with research-supported content. Each lesson includes 5 pages of extremely valuable content including: TOPIC OVERVIEW: 2 pages of reading material providing background information on the lesson topic for the service provider. These pages include research-supported content and references from relevant literature. - PARENT HANDOUT: 1 page that serves as an easy-to-read handout for parents - TOPIC EXPLORATION FORM: 1 page we call the “Topic Exploration Form,” which helps the parent training session to stay focused, address medically necessary content, and helps guide the session - ultimately to provide optimal value to your client! - PARENT ACTIVITY: 1 page designed as a homework assignment or activity that the parent can do outside of the session (or with the provider if they prefer) The worksheets and handouts in the curriculum may be copied for the book owner's entire caseload or personal use. Additional users must purchase a new copy per copyright. This book is designed for professionals who work with parents with a child with autism spectrum disorder. However, the majority of the curriculum is not autism-specific and, therefore, may also benefit other youth, including children with ADHD, behavioral difficulties, communication delays, and even typically developing children. This book includes 149 pages of research-supported content to help you streamline your ABA parent training services while providing high-quality behavioral intervention.
